How is this program structured?

Federal Grants Simplified is divided into six consecutive modules. You also get access to LIVE, weekly Q&A sessions to discuss the training and other federal grant topics--including a current application or award compliance issue. Six quizzes are also included so you can gauge how much you learned.

MODULE 1

Federal Grants Overview

How federal grants are used, what they fund, & how to apply

MODULE 2

Pre-Award Success

Learn how to use Grants.gov, USASpending.gov, and SAM.gov

MODULE 3

Mastering the Application Process:

As a team decipher the solicitation, budget building, and supporting documents

MODULE 4

Congratulations! 

Your organization was awarded a federal grant... Now what?

MODULE 5

Post-Award Success

Managing federal and other government grants using Uniform Guidance

MODULE 6

Compliance is Not a Choice

Program and financial reports, subrecipient monitoring, and successful award closeout

Meet Patrice 

My name is Patrice Davis, and I am the founder and CEO of Grants Works, a grant consulting company, and the lead trainer for Grants Works Academy.

I have over 15 years of experience managing or overseeing federal grants for large and small nonprofits and a top research university.  I reviewed compliance variables of grant continuation applications when I was employed as a public health analyst at the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. 

I have managed federal awards as a recipient, sub-recipient, and pass-through entity, and my work as a federal employee helped inform my experience.

I also was a fiscal consultant on site monitoring visits of state agency recipients of federal grants.

Since 2005, I successfully applied for and administered over $131 million in federal, state, and county grant funding from 20+ city, county, state, and federal agencies.

I provided training on Uniform Guidance (2 CFR 200), HHS’ adoption of Uniform Guidance (45 CFR 75), and managing grant-funded travel.

I am a member of the National Grant Management Association, Grant Professionals Association, and Georgia Grant Professionals Association.
